Правильный выбор компилятора в Qt при использовании наборов MSVC - PullRequest
0 голосов
/ 22 сентября 2019

Я знаю, что Qt автоматически обнаруживает компиляторы MSVC, но иногда это не работает, как ожидалось!Поскольку я разместил изображение, я хочу знать, что означает название каждого компилятора и для какого набора я должен выбрать один из этих компиляторов?например, каковы различия между amd64 и x86-amd64 и мне следует выбрать amd64 для компиляции на 64-битной машине с целью 64-битной машины?

https://i.stack.imgur.com/4QySg.png

1 Ответ

0 голосов
/ 22 сентября 2019

первое имя относится к типу исполняемого файла компилятора, или, другими словами, относится к типу архитектуры ОС, необходимой для запуска компилятора.в то время как другое имя относится к типу исполняемого файла, который создается компилятором

, например x86-amd64, означает, что компилятор может работать в 32-битной системе и создает 64-битные исполняемые файлы, в то время как amd64 толькоозначает, что компилятор работает в 64-битной системе и производит 64-битные исполняемые файлы

Я надеюсь, что смогу объяснить это как можно яснее

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...